Dated it may be, but the Illustrated Hassle Free Make Your Own Clothes book set quite a few of us on the path of costuming, sewing and patternmaking. I for one was delighted to be freed from the tyranny of the pattern companies, whose size range, at that time, stopped at 14. Using their method of tracing existing garments helped me make some simple yet pretty dresses, tops,and pants, and that gave me the confidence and interest to learn more.


It's very much the counterpart of a number of new books I'm seeing, that are geared at teens and twenty-somethings who are also beginning sewers. These new books also have the themes of, draft your own patterns, create your individual style, recycle; and the same tone of, it's easy, jump right in. The styles are different and so is the slang, but that will be true of these new books in just a few years.
